Northpower and Staff Reach Agreement over Pay Negotiations
Today management and staff reached agreement over pay details for the next 15 months, and avoided a potential one-day stoppage which had been scheduled for next week.
Management, staff and the unions have been working hard to reach agreement that would ensure both the Company and staff positions were met. In a meeting today, 99% of staff accepted the Company offer.
While the Company had
contingency plans to ensure minimal impact on the
electricity supply to customers, Northpower Chief Executive,
Mark Gatland, said “we are pleased that we have achieved
both the objectives of the Company and that of our staff,
without disruption to the
business”.
